DURHAM – No. 11 Duke welcomes the Campbell Camels to town to open a four-game homestand at Jack Coombs Field. First pitch is scheduled for 4 p.m. and admission is free.
Fans can park in either the Grounds Lot or Science Drive Garage for Tuesday's contest.

QUICK HITS
- The Blue Devils have pounded the baseball out of the yard this season, while also limiting the number of round trippers they have allowed on the mound. Duke is tied for first in the ACC with a plus-34 home run differential with Virginia Tech.
- Head coach Chris Pollard tied Steve Traylor (1988-99) for second all-time with 356 wins at Duke on Sunday. Pollard is now 25 wins away from tying legendary head coach Jack Coombs (1929-52) for first on the all-time Duke wins list with 381. The 12th year skipper is nine wins from collecting his 750th career victory.
- Senior catcher Alex Stone climbed into a tie for fifth all-time on the career home run list for Duke, hitting his 32nd and 33rd in a Blue Devils' uniform on Sunday against NC State. The multi-home run game moved him even with Gregg Maluchinuk (1995-98) who hit 33 home runs during his time in Durham. The career home run record was set by Nate Freiman (2006-09) who crushed 43 home runs in a Duke uniform.
- Freshman AJ Gracia continues to chase greatness for Duke in his first season. He began the year with a 22-game reached base streak and added his seventh home run of the year on Saturday against NC State. Gracia now sits five home runs away from breaking Andrew Fischer's freshman home run record of 11. The Monroe, N.J., native has started all 24 games, producing a slash line of .337/.651/.477, while leading the team in walks with 19.
- The Blue Devils continue to prove why they are one of the best pitching staff in the country, the strikeouts numbers are quickly adding up for opponents. Duke has now punched out 267 batters, holding opponents to a .193 average at the plate. That mark is on pace to break last year's program record of 675 total strikeouts.
